Design And Implementation Of Recognition System On The Froth Flotation Image Of Ilmenite

Titanium resource is an important strategic resource.To efficiently extract ilmenite from the tailings of vanadium titano-magnetite,promote the recovery rate of ilmenite,using flotation automatic control system can reduce the labor intensity and optimize operating environment.Image recognition system of ilmenite foam is basis for flotation automatic control system.With control parameters provided by the image recognition system,the automatic control system of flotation can dynamically adjust the relevant parameters based on foam flotation conditions,and achieve stable and efficient production as the model is continuously optimized.Based on the flotation process of other minerals,a suit of foam image recognition system adaptable for ilmenite flotation is designed in this paper.Through the industrial camera,the foam image is captured and transmitted to the server in which pre-processing of image are carried out.By simulating quality criteria of engineers on site,important characteristic parameters such as color characteristics of the image HSI color space,the size and number of foam,foam movement speed,and the Tamura texture feature of foam are selected.These characteristics can reflect the quality and defects of foam well.Based on extracted foam characteristic parameters and acquired parameters on-site,a sample database is established with expert experiences and later test results.Due to small quantity of the sample data,combined with characteristics of the sample and the classification algorithm,the paper tests two mainstream algorithms of classification.The machine learning algorithm based on SVM finally be chosen,and an expert system based on the algorithm is established to judge the quality of foam,finally the system is developed.Judged by the expert system with real-time data,it predicts the quality and then gives alarm information or operation suggestions,output control parameters,real-time trend graphs and historical data query.The system,deployed and tested in 2# concentration tank of flotation workshop of Xinbaima Mining Co.,Ltd.,Panzhihua Mining Group,can judges foam quality close to the artificial normal judgment level,which achieves the operation guidance of flotation process and output of control parameters.The next step is going to improve the prediction level and promote stable performance of the system,and then extend to all the flotation tanks.
